CHECK VALVE (SOLUTION OUTLET)


Inspect the check valve whenever doing service on
the chemical pump or if flow problems occur in the
chemical system:


1. Remove the check valve. Be sure the small o-

ring for the seat comes out with the check valve.


2. Remove the seat, using a 5/16" Allen wrench.

3. Check the Teflon seat for debris or wear. Clean

or replace Teflon seat if needed.


4. Clean the poppet and spring, inspect for wear or

damage, and replace as needed.


5. Re-assemble the check valve. Start the seat by

hand, tighten using a 5/16" Allen wrench. DO
NOT
over-tighten seat.

NOTE: Improper seating of the check valve
poppet, damaged spring or o-rings will cause
poor operation of the chemical system.

6.
Lubricate the o-rings with o-ring lubricant
Part #05-008035 and reinstall.















CHEMICAL PUMP


The only repairs which the chemical pump may
require is the replacement of the diaphragm or
check valves. To replace the diaphragm, unscrew
the cover from the body. When replacing the
diaphragm, lubricate the outer edges of the
diaphragm with o-ring lubricant Part #05-008035 and
reassemble. To replace the check valves, unscrew
the check valve caps. Replace the check valves and
reassemble, using new o-rings.

DO NOT attempt to re-use o-rings once the check
valves have been removed. See the “Illustrated
Parts Listing” for a parts break-down on the chemical
pump.
